Overview
A signage platform for digital menu boards and in-store displays across the restaurant group. Content is managed centrally and pushed to screens remotely — price changes, promos, and menu updates go live everywhere in minutes with consistent branding.
The problem
Menu and price changes meant printing, driving to stores, and hoping every location got updated. Screens drifted out of sync, promos launched late, and branding varied by store.
Architecture
A central CMS stores layouts, playlists, and schedules. Display clients on each screen maintain a WebSocket connection for instant pushes, cache content locally to survive network drops, and report health so dead screens are caught remotely.
architecture-diagramCMS → push service (WebSocket) → display clients with offline cache + health reporting
Highlights
- —Remote updates in minutes Price or menu changes publish to every store at once — no printing, no store visits.
- —Offline resilience Screens cache content locally and keep playing through network drops, syncing when back online.
- —Consistent branding Centralized templates keep every location's boards on-brand automatically.
